HMT was founded in 1978, specifically for the purpose of providing quality products and services for the maintenance and repair of Aboveground storage tanks.   HMT's field services include the inspection, repair and retrofit of Aboveground tanks.  This service work includes not only routine maintenance projects, but the special repairs and replacements required due to corrosion, deterioration, or damage due to wind, fire or sinking of floating roofs.  HMT has the technical expertise to evaluate the specific conditions and determine the most appropriate corrective action to be taken.

HMT differentiates itself from local and global competitors by offering outstanding technical expertise, service and proprietary products and services which exceed EPA standards and are better designed than any other on the market.  HMT serves a market segment which is growing due to increased EPA legislation and an effort by oil and gas companies to increase the usable service lives of their aging tank population.

HMT is an active participant in the Petroleum Industry and is involved with such organizations as the American Petroleum Institute (API), the National Petroleum Refiners Association (NPRA), and the Independent Liquid Terminals Association (ILTA).  HMT is a member of API's Refining Division Tank and Vessel Subcommittee, responsible for such documents as API Standard 620, API 650 and API 653. 

HMT Services include:

Inspection

HMT offers the latest in NDE equipment for Aboveground Storage Tank inspections, spheres, and piping with fully qualified ASNT, API 653, 570 & 510 certified inspectors. Our engineering services include evaluations per API 653, API 570 & API 510.

Maintenance & Repair
HMT provides tank repair and maintenance services, including bottom replacements, shell repairs, fixed and floating roof repairs and replacements, tank re-Leveling, fittings and appurtenances, special design and engineering work, as well as specialty fabrication and construction project work.

New Tanks
HMT New Tank Construction Services include the construction of field erected storage tanks to various design standards and specifications, such as API, AWWA and specialty design.  In addition to the actual tank construction, this Group provides full design and engineering, civil and mechanical, painting, and other related tank services.

Turnkey
HMT provides Turnkey Tank Maintenance Management Services to include any or all of the various Tank Maintenance services provided by HMT, including maintenance planning, cleaning, inspection, repair, product installation, civil and mechanical work, testing, painting and coating, and commissioning.  HMT assists tank owners in their Maintenance Management programs, providing a "customized" service designed to meet specific facility needs and requirements.

Government
HMT's Government Services group has been organized to effectively manage the provision of all the company's current products and services to federal, state and local agencies while maintaining the proper documentation often associated with governmental agency contracts.

Painting, Coating & Lining

HMT's Painting, Coating and Lining Services include a wide variety of internal and external industrial applications for tanks, vessels, piping and other metal and non-metal structures.  This Group is experienced in determining the most appropriate coating system for the proposed service environment, including standard and non-standard surface preparation, application methods and techniques and multi-coat systems.

 

Calibration

HMT Calibration Services include tank calibration, or "strapping" measurement.  The service provided also includes the measurement of barges, ships and any liquid bulk container.  These measurements provide the necessary dimensions for the calculation of capacity tables.  These measurements and the measurements procedures comply with all applicable API Standards for Tank Calibration.
